From: OsPHR3 affects the traits governing nitrogen homeostasis in rice

Fig. 7

Responses of OsPHR3 expression and lateral roots development in osphr3 under H/L NO3− are Pi-independent. Seeds of the WT and mutants (osphr3–1 and 3–2) were grown hydroponically in media comprising H NO3− + P, H NO3− -P, L NO3− + P and L NO3− -P for 10 d. a The relative expression level of OsPHR3 under different NO3− and Pi conditions. b Phenotype of primordia in 2–4 cm region from the tip of seminal root. d Seedlings showing lateral roots phenotype. Data are presented for (c )number of lateral root primordia, (e) average length and (f) density of lateral roots in 2–4 cm region from the tip of seminal root. Values are means ±SE (n = 10) and different letters on the histograms indicate that the values differ significantly (P < 0.05, one-way ANOVA)
